What's Happening?
As the United States celebrates its 250th anniversary, CNN Travel highlights the ongoing trend of high airfares despite a significant drop in jet fuel prices. This situation has led to a renewed interest in domestic travel, with many Americans opting
to explore local destinations rather than travel abroad. CNN Travel has released its list of America's 10 Best Towns to Visit for 2026, encouraging people to discover lesser-known communities and unique attractions within the country. The list includes places like Roanoke, Virginia, known for its outdoor adventures and vibrant food scene. Additionally, various events are taking place across the nation, such as the Sail250 event featuring a flotilla of tall ships and military vessels, and the journey of the world's largest operating steam locomotive from Pennsylvania to Wyoming.
